Comics try not to bomb. The audiences judges. Someone gets beat up.
Ryan Foster and Drew Montana host a stand-up comedy show that lets the audience judge if you bombed or not.
Simple: a comic performs, you scan a QR code and submit a form of judgement (anon if you like), the hosts read out the snarky comments.
Funniest comment of the night wins $20. WHOA
PLUS open mics lottery spots for any comics or audience brave enough to get up and give it a try. Drop your name in the hat, and be one of the lucky ones to try not to suck.
